Fish Farm giants Marine Harvest will continue their sponsorship of Cuillin FM’s “Camanachd Live” show throughout the 2015 shinty season.
The sponsorship will allow Cuillin FM to continue their live shinty coverage which won them the Marine Harvest Media award last year.
Cuillin FM’s “Camanachd Live” provided live commentary from 31 shinty matches over 27 Saturdays last season, covering eleven different shinty competitions.
The sponsorship allows Cuillin FM to take their outside broadcast unit to various shinty grounds and they visited seven different venues during 2013:
- Pairc nan Laoch, Portree
- Battery Park, Lochcarron
- Kirkton, Balmacara
- Craigard, Invergarry
- Blairbeg, Drumnadrochit
- An Aird, Fort William
- Playing Fields, Taynuilt
The west coast radio station’s first shinty broadcast was in February 2010 when they covered the Iomain Cholmcille meeting between Alba and Eirinn at Pairc nan Laoch, Portree. They have provided live commentary of domestic shinty matches since the start of the 2011 shinty season.
As well as listening locally, shinty fans from across the world can pick up the online stream at www.cuillinfm.co.uk.
The coverage is provided by match commentator Alasdair Bruce and summarisers Drew Millar, Keith MacKenzie and Ross Brown.
